Breakfast Menu At Powersfield House

Eunice Power Of Powersfield House Winner in the 2004 National Porridge Making Competition

Breakfast a Powersfield House is an absolute treat. Everything is handmade from the delicious jams and chutneys to the infamous brown bread. Eunice was the County Waterford winner of the 2004 and 2005 National Porridge Making Competition, her oatmeal treats are not to be missed. Breakfast is served from 8.00am to 10.00am…or later. Breakfast in bed is also available. Our Breakfast menu is based around fresh seasonal ingredients, cooked to perfection giving you an excellent start to the day.

Dungarvan is one of Irelands best kept secrets. Situated on a little peninsula with the most beautiful beaches and only minutes away from mountains and leafy woodlands. Nearby is the bountiful Blackwater River, perfect for fly fishing. The town itself is a busy market town with excellent shops, restaurants and superb art galleries. Powersfield house is an ideal location from which to explore West Waterford.
